1. A method for treating Parkinson's disease in a patient in need thereof, comprising:
subcutaneously administering to the patient a liquid medicament comprising: levodopa and carbidopa, wherein subcutaneously administering comprises:
providing a device comprising:
a reusable part comprising:
a drive component; and
a control unit for controlling the drive component; and
a disposable part engageable with the reusable part, the disposable part comprising:
a reservoir that contains the liquid medicament, wherein the reservoir comprises a bushing, the bushing fixedly mounted in the reservoir;
a plunger head moveable by a lead screw in the reservoir;
and
a nut concentrically secured by and rotatable in the bushing, the nut threadedly engaged with a thread of the lead screw
engaging the reusable part with the disposable part thereby detachably coupling the nut with the drive component;
fluidically coupling the reservoir to the subcutaneous tissue of the patient;
rotating the nut in the bushing to linearly displace the lead screw; and thereby
administering the liquid medicament from the reservoir to the subcutaneous tissue of the patient.
